For raised beds in the Beckenham area, most projects fall between £200–£800 per bed depending on size, height and material. Sleeper beds are often the most cost-effective, while brick, stone or metal can cost more due to materials and labour. If you’re installing multiple beds, adding steps, or bringing in large volumes of soil, typical overall spend can be £400–£1,500.
Most raised bed installations take 1–2 days from ground preparation to final tidy-up. A single sleeper bed can sometimes be completed in a day, while brick or stone beds usually take longer due to foundations, setting and finishing. Access in BR3 gardens, the amount of excavation, and whether we’re removing old edging or turf can all affect the timescale. We’ll confirm a clear schedule before starting.
Raised beds are usually classed as minor garden works and don’t require planning permission in the London Borough of Bromley. However, rules can change if you live in a listed building, a conservation area, or if the bed forms part of a larger structure (retaining walls, significant changes in levels, or boundary works). We’ll flag any potential issues during the site visit and advise if you should check with the council.
